On Thursday, March 19th, some Lee Hall students in grades 3-5 participated in a videoconference with a different purpose. This videoconference was designed to make people laugh. The event was titled the Hilarious Halls of Lee Hall and it truly was hilarious. Students auditioned to be part of this comedy/talent show. Their audience was a children's hospital in New Jersey for their program called Giggles Theater. We wanted to brighten the day of these sick children in the hospital. Mission accomplished, laughs were plentiful thoughout our building and the hospital.
We had a multitude of acts, including singing, dancing, stepping, juggling, and joke telling. There were skits performed and even a Three Stooges performance. The comedic timing was perfect and I truly beileve we have some future entertainers in this group. Kids, remember where you got your first big break.
Congratulations to all students who participated, you did an amazing job and you brightened the day of many children. I will leave you with a joke. Why did the lion spit out the clown? Because he tasted funny! :)
